The material presented at this conference is specifically designed to educate cardiology care providers, providing them with the most up-to-date information regarding multimodality imaging for the diagnosis and treatment of heart disease. This course will fulfill these elements by: 1. reviewing the basic technical issues of echocardiography as well as CT, MRI, and nuclear imaging, 2. discussing relevant advances in techniques and limitations of each modality, and 3. providing a comprehensive update of the clinical uses of the techniques in the diagnosis and prognosis of common cardiovascular diseases in a clinical case based format.
